Implantable Collamer Lenses, also called ICL, are small lenses placed inside the eye to correct vision problems like shortsightedness, longsightedness, and astigmatism. They are different from traditional contact lenses as they are implanted in the eye and are a permanent solution for vision problems.
This procedure has a lot of benefits, but the most incredible one is that the lenses are made of a biocompatible material called Collamer, which is designed to work with the natural structure of the eyes.
This surgery is done to correct various eye disorders, and one of the great advantages and usage is that it’s recommended and beneficial to patients with high degrees of refractive error and thin cornea that are considered not suitable for other eye surgeries.
What’s more, ICL is a safe and effective solution for people as it provides them with clear and sharp vision and saves them the stress of using glasses or contact lenses. Let’s look at some of the top benefits of Implantable Collamer Lenses.

Wide Range of Vision Correction
The versatility of Implantable Collamer Lenses makes them a good choice for patients looking for how to correct different ranges of refractive errors, including nearsightedness up to -30D, farsightedness up to +10D, and astigmatism up to 10D. This is a comprehensive correction that makes it possible for ICL to restore visions, especially in people with different vision needs. It provides tailored solutions for each individual’s unique needs.

Suitable for Thin Cornea
Another incredible benefit of ICL is that it’s even suitable for people with thin corneas because it’s different from Lasik eye surgery in that it requires some part of the cornea to be removed. Here, your cornea will remain intact. The process just involves implanting a lens, bending your iris, and placing it in front of the natural lens. It preserves your corneal structure and integrity.

Minimal Dry Eye Symptoms
The procedure is different from traditional contact lenses because it doesn’t come in direct contact with your cornea. This reduces the risks of dry eye symptoms. The feature also allows for great comfort and eye health, allowing patients to enjoy clear division without the discomfort that comes with wearing contact lenses.

Risks and Complications with Implantable Collamer Lens
Potential side effects of ICL include infection, inflammation, cataracts, glare, and halos when around lights. Before performing the surgery, your surgeon will discuss all the complications and help you make the right decision about your options.
